BREED HISTORY.

From Wikipedea.

Some sources credit Colonel Edward Donald Malcolm and his kin of Poltalloch in the Argyll region of western Scotland as an originator of this breed in the 19th century. It is thought that the breed gained its white coat after Colonel Edward Donald Malcolm's red terrier was mistaken for a fox and shot. Thus, the breed was only to be white in colour as to help distinguish it from its quarry. Other sources credit the 8th Duke of Argyll (Chieftain of Clan Campbell) as an originator.

The Westie came to the United States in the early 1900s, originally proclaimed Roseneath Terrior. The name was changed to manifest the breed's origins.

Some dog breeders and lovers incorrectly believe that Westies developed from white dogs in the litters of Cairn Terriers.
